Bear Stearns (BSC) Jumps In Pre-Open Trading

November 14, 2007 9:07 AM EST
Bear Stearns (NYSE: BSC) is trading 6.4% higher in pre-open action following comments on a Merrill Lynch conference.

Investors are feeling better after the company said it sees a Q4 writedown of $1.2 billion and said it now has a net subprime exposure of negative $52 million, versus $1 billion at the end of August. CDO related exposure is now at $884 million, down from $2 billion.

The company also said it hopes the worst in mortgages is behind them.
